I understand that the Canada Path to Retirement program was offered to employees 55 years old and older with at least five years at IBM, or employees with at least 30 years at IBM. The offer was for 3 months of severance pay, and leading up to that, employment for 3 months working 3 days a week but being paid for 4 days a week.
